Mardi Gras Indians, or Black Masking Indians, spend months, thousands of dollars preparing hand-sewn suits The Mardi Gras Indians, or Black Masking Indians, have been around since the 1800s. Members spend months painstakingly handcrafting suits to be worn while marching through New Orleans' neighborhoods.

Why are many New Orleans porch ceilings painted blue? The history spans back centuries. The color is called "haint" blue, and the story on why we paint with it starts with the Gullah people in 19th century South Carolina.

“Slow Pay, Low Pay or No Pay”: Trial Reveals How Insurers Try to Wield Power Over Doctors Blue Cross authorized mastectomies and breast reconstructions for women with cancer but refused to pay the full doctors’ bills. A jury called it fraud and awarded the practice $421 million.

Blue Cross had refused to pay thousands of claims for the center’s patients, but on several occasions executives at the insurance company had signed special one-time deals with the center to pay for their wives’ cancer treatment.
